[quote]Thanks! I guess a question would be is this new analysis considered more sensitive in digging the signals out of the data, or perhaps it is just another way of approaching the problem, or perhaps it is analyzing data that has not been analyzed previously?[/quote]
The latter. The S5 LSC Science run lasted about two and a half years, when we started S5R2/3 only the data of the first year was available. S5R4 is looking at the rest of the data from S5, where the sensitivity of the detectors was higher than in the first year. Also we got more usable data out of the second year, which improves the sensitivity of the analysis. That, however, also means that for the workunits the data volume has increased and the amount of computational work necessary to process them, too.
BM
S5R4和S5R3的主要区别:
LSC的S5阶段大概持续了两年半,之前本项目的R2/R3都只是分析第一年的数据,而R4是分析后来的数据,这时的探测器已经比前一年更为灵敏。第二年的运行过程也得到了更多有用的数据,这可以提高分析过程的灵敏度,因此,R4任务单元的数据容量有所增加,相应的,处理数据所需的时间也会有相应的增加。
